Excel Sort by Date Not Working: Fixes

2 min read 24-10-2024
Excel Sort by Date Not Working: Fixes

Table of Contents :

Sorting data by date in Excel can sometimes be a frustrating task, especially when it seems like the sorting feature is not working correctly. This issue can arise due to various reasons, such as incorrect date formatting or hidden characters in your data. In this blog post, we will explore some common reasons why sorting by date may fail in Excel and provide you with effective fixes. Let’s dive in! 📅✨

Understanding Date Formats in Excel

Importance of Date Format

Excel recognizes date data in specific formats. If your dates are not formatted correctly, Excel may treat them as text, which disrupts the sorting process. To effectively sort dates, ensure that they are formatted as dates rather than strings.

Common Date Formats

Format Example
Short Date 04/15/2023
Long Date April 15, 2023
ISO Date 2023-04-15

Important Note: When entering dates, ensure that your regional settings match the format used in your data.

Fixes for Excel Sort by Date Not Working

1. Check for Text Format

If your dates are formatted as text, Excel will not sort them correctly. Here’s how you can convert them to date format:

  • Select the Column: Click on the header of the column containing your dates.
  • Change Format:
    • Right-click and select Format Cells.
    • Choose Date from the Category list.
  • Use the Date Value Function: If there are still issues, use the =DATEVALUE() function to convert text dates into Excel dates.

2. Remove Hidden Characters

Sometimes, hidden characters can interfere with sorting. Follow these steps to clean your data:

  • Trim Spaces: Use the TRIM() function to remove any extra spaces. For example, =TRIM(A1) can clean up the date in cell A1.
  • Check for Non-breaking Spaces: Use the CLEAN() function to remove non-printable characters, like =CLEAN(A1).

3. Ensure No Blank Cells

Blank cells can disrupt the sorting process. Follow these steps to check for and remove blank cells:

  • Filter Your Data: Apply a filter to your dataset and check for any empty cells within the date column.
  • Delete or Replace Blanks: You can either delete these rows or fill them with a default date (like 01/01/1900).

4. Sort the Data Properly

Once you've ensured all dates are formatted correctly and free from errors, sort your data:

  1. Select Your Data Range: Click and drag to select the entire range of data you want to sort.
  2. Go to Data Tab: Click on the Data tab in the Excel ribbon.
  3. Sort: Choose Sort Ascending or Sort Descending based on your preference.

5. Use the Sort Feature in Table Format

If your data is in a table format, sorting is even more straightforward. Here’s how to do it:

  • Convert Range to Table: Select your data and press Ctrl + T to convert it into a table.
  • Use the Dropdown: Click the dropdown arrow in the header of your date column, then choose Sort Oldest to Newest or Sort Newest to Oldest.

Final Tips for Successful Date Sorting

  • Always Verify Data: After sorting, double-check the data to ensure that it has been sorted correctly. It’s essential to make sure no discrepancies have occurred during the sorting process.
  • Save Your Work: Before making significant changes, always save your work to avoid any data loss.

By following these tips and understanding the importance of proper formatting, you should be able to resolve issues with sorting by date in Excel effectively. Happy sorting! 📊🎉